Identify The Problem To Be Solved
There are many ways to communicate effectively with staff. But before you can decide which app is right for you, you need to identify the problem that you’re trying to solve.
For example, are you looking for an easy way to share information and updates with staff? Are you looking for a way to get staff input on a particular issue or topic? Or are you hoping to create a conversation around a subject or area of concern? Are you hoping to facilitate communication among different teams, groups, or departments?

What Is Your Goal?
Before choosing a communication app, make sure you know what your goal is. Some apps are to facilitate collaboration while others are to facilitate communication.
Some apps are designed to facilitate communication while others are to facilitate collaboration. For example, Yammer is a social media platform that’s used for sharing information and connecting with colleagues.
Others, like Slack, are primarily used for facilitating collaboration. Determine your goal first, then find an app that meets your needs.
What Type Of Communication Are You Looking For?
There are many different types of communication available to you: group chat, private chat, video chat, phone call, or in-person meeting. Each app offers a different type of communication.
If you’re looking to host the conversation on your servers, how important is security? Are you looking for something that can be from any device? Are you looking for something that integrates with your existing systems or software?
